To explain a little better, I have an 82 XJ650 Maxim. The 2nd gear is out and from what I understand it would cost less to just put a different engine in that has a tranny rather than have someone fix the tranny on the 650. I have access to a 750 Maxim engine and was wondering if everything will bolt ok on the 650 Maxim frame ? Or are there some problems I may encounter ?

I think the swap should be fine, but you may run into problems w/ the exhaust mount points. Compare and measure the frames etc out but it's all the same engine, shouldn't be too different.

Definitely more expensive to fix the gear on the 650 ... even if you have to get some motor or exhaust mounts fabbed on your frame, it still shouldn't be as much as the cost to break down the negine and rebuild it.
